Introduction

Symbol is a company that supports people with learning disabilities. We believe that anything is possible and support local people with learning disabilities to help them lead truly fulfilling lives.

Our Residential Parenting Assessment Service aims to promote the value of family life for parents who have special needs and/or other vulnerabilities who run the risk of their child being taken from their care. We aim to assist parents to develop their bond with their children, understanding the needs of their children, and beginning to develop their skills and insights to fulfil those needs. Where families face difficult issues and choices within their own family life, our team is on hand to work through this process and to assist them in placing the needs of their children first.

Role and Responsibilities

  1. To ensure the social work provision within Symbol’s Family Assessment Service meets the aims, objectives, and quality standards of Symbol and all relevant statutory requirements relating to children and vulnerable adult procedures and social work practices.
  2. To make a senior contribution to the delivery of high-quality assessment, care planning, and support to meet the unique needs of our clients in line with Symbol’s Mission Statement, Aims and Objectives.
  3. Assist in the provision of a skilled multi-disciplinary assessment of families with special needs and/or vulnerabilities where there is concern over their ability to parent their children.
  4. To work closely with the families in our care to ensure they receive a social work service that is responsive to their needs and is focused on positive outcomes.
  5. To work with the Registered Manager of the service to ensure the safety and well-being of the children and vulnerable adults resident through careful and thorough risk assessment.
  6. To work with the Registered Manager and wider professional network around the child and vulnerable adults to follow appropriate safeguarding procedures if concerns arise.
  7. The post holder will serve as a key point of reference in relation to safeguarding the service.

Experience and Suitability

We are looking for an experienced Social Work Practitioner with a degree in Social Work as approved by the Health & Care Professions Council. Child Protection Social Work experience is required as well as a familiarity with the family courts processes. We are looking for a Practitioner who is committed to and enthusiastic about working with vulnerable children and clients. An ability to work with vulnerable individuals in a person-centered and empathetic manner is necessary.

Additionally, you will need:

  1. Good communication skills – both written and verbal.
  2. Listening and observational skills.
  3. Personal resilience and ability to support and manage potentially stressful and challenging situations well.
  4. Strong organisational skills and capacity to self-manage workload in order to meet deadlines.
  5. Understanding and experience of the legal frameworks and processes around child protection.
  6. An ability to integrate within a professional team and work jointly within a multi-disciplinary team in order to deliver the aims and objectives of the residential assessment service.
